Paper 2014/789

Statistical Properties of the Square Map Modulo a Power of Two

S. M. Dehnavi, A. Mahmoodi Rishakani, M. R. Mirzaee Shamsabad, and Einollah Pasha

Abstract

The square map is one of the functions that is used in cryptography. For instance, the square map is used in Rabin encryption scheme, block cipher RC6 and stream cipher Rabbit, in different forms. In this paper we study a special case of the square map, namely the square function modulo a power of two. We obtain probability distribution of the output of this map as a vectorial Boolean function. We find probability distribution of the component Boolean functions of this map. We present the joint probability distribution of the component Boolean functions of this function. We introduce a new function which is similar to the function that is used in Rabbit cipher and we compute the probability distribution of the component Boolean functions of this new map.

Note: This paper is an English version of a paper in Persian, which was presented in ISCISC'14

Metadata
Available format(s)
PDF
Category
Foundations
Publication info
Published elsewhere. ISCISC'14
Keywords
Square map modulo a power of twoVectorial Boolean functionComponent Boolean functionRabbit cipher
Contact author(s)
std_dehnavism @ khu ac ir
History
2015-04-14: last of 3 revisions
2014-10-07: received
See all versions
Short URL
https://ia.cr/2014/789
License
Creative Commons Attribution
CC BY

BibTeX

@misc{cryptoeprint:2014/789,
      author = {S.  M.  Dehnavi and A.  Mahmoodi Rishakani and M.  R.  Mirzaee Shamsabad and Einollah Pasha},
      title = {Statistical Properties of the Square Map Modulo a Power of Two},
      howpublished = {Cryptology ePrint Archive, Paper 2014/789},
      year = {2014},
      note = {\url{https://eprint.iacr.org/2014/789}},
      url = {https://eprint.iacr.org/2014/789}
}
Note: In order to protect the privacy of readers, eprint.iacr.org does not use cookies or embedded third party content.